Marlins Fall Short in Opener vs Twins

Miami Marlins lose to Minnesota Twins in a close 3-0 game, despite Eury Perezs strong performance. The Twins pitching staff, ranked 24th in the league, dominated with Bailey Obers complete game shutout. Marlins bats went cold, leaving Perezs effort in vain. The team struggles on the road and needs to improve their hitting to climb the NL East standings. Upcoming games against the Twins could be crucial for their season. JJ Wetherholt: Cardinals' Rising Star

JJ Wetherholt, a 23-year-old St. Louis Cardinals prospect, is making waves with his exceptional skills on both offense and defense. His defensive prowess, ranking in the ninety-ninth percentile, and his offensive contributions, including eight homers and a .783 OPS, have earned him a spot in the teams top two for wins above replacement. Wetherholt, along with teammates Jordan Walker and others, is part of a young core poised to lead the Cardinals for years to come, following strategic offseason trades that cleared the path for their rise. Braves Honor Legends Turner & Cox, Weiss & Francoeur Share Stories

The Atlanta Braves honored the late Ted Turner and Bobby Cox, setting a reflective tone for their series against the Chicago Cubs. Former player Walt Weiss shared how Coxs leadership shaped him, creating a clubhouse culture of unbreakable loyalty. Current manager Weiss aims to extend Coxs foundational ways, keeping the respect alive for the Braves brand. Former player Jeff Francoeur recalled a classic story of Coxs casual advice during an ejection, highlighting Coxs massive footprint in Braves history.
